OSHA has released an updated fact sheet on its vaccine and testing emergency temporary standard (ETS) that reflects the new compliance dates of January 10 for most provisions of the ETS and February 9 for the standard’s testing requirements. On Friday, the Supreme Court heard expedited oral arguments regarding judicial stays facing two federal vaccine mandates concerning COVID-19: OSHA’s ETS on COVID-19 for employers with 100 or more employees and the Healthcare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) Interim Final Rule (the “CMS Rule”) covering certain health care providers. The court is not currently deciding the legality of the ETS, only whether it may be implemented while lawsuits challenging it continue.
